A note on spelling. In the USA, and countries that follow US English, the spelling is ALUMINUM. However in the UK, and countries that follow British English, the spelling is ALUMINIUM (with an extra 'I'). We use the British spelling in the cartoons, but for balance use the US spelling in the text. We hope that is not too confusing!
